Farmer jailed for 14 years for blackmail and contaminating baby food

A 45-year-old sheep farmer has today (October 12) been jailed for 14 years after being convicted of blackmail and contaminating specific ranges of baby food. A man has been charged after cocaine worth around £6 million at street level was seized at the Port of Holyhead

The drugs were seized as part of an investigation involving the National Crime Agency, the Police Service of Northern Ireland and Border Force. Officers from Border Force found around 83kg of cocaine concealed within a lorry load of refrigerated goods.

Wedding organiser becomes the first person in Essex to receive £10,000 COVID fine

THE organiser of a wedding party in Margaretting has become the first person in Essex to be fined £10,000 for organising a large gathering.
